About

Feed the Animals is a single player action game. It was developed by Attila Vitez and was released on November 30, 2017. It received positive reviews from players.

This game helps improving children's coordination skills. "Grab an animal and help them reach their destination: a crate of food. But be careful not to touch any of the tree stumps." Level 18 is a bonus where you ought to avoid windblown leaves and collect the apples, with Ladybird.
